cnc车床代码有哪些

  • 2025-02-14 12:11:41

CNC车床代码是控制数控车床运行的关键,它是由一系列指令组成的程序,用于告诉机床如何进行加工操作。在CNC车床代码中,包含了各种功能和指令,可以实现不同的加工需求。本文将从多个方面详细阐述CNC车床代码的内容和作用,为读者提供全面的背景信息。

1. G代码

G代码是CNC车床代码中最基本的部分,它用于定义机床的运动轨迹和加工方式。G代码包含了各种指令,如G00用于快速定位,G01用于直线插补,G02和G03用于圆弧插补等。通过编写不同的G代码,可以实现机床在不同位置和方向上的运动,从而完成不同的加工操作。

2. M代码

M代码是CNC车床代码中用于控制机床辅助功能的指令。它可以控制机床的开关状态、刀具的进给和退刀、冷却液的开启和关闭等。M代码的作用非常重要,它能够保证机床在加工过程中的安全和稳定运行。

3. T代码

T代码用于选择机床上的刀具,它可以告诉机床使用哪种刀具进行加工。在CNC车床代码中,通过编写T代码,可以实现自动换刀功能,提高加工效率和精度。

4. F代码

F代码用于设置进给速度,它决定了机床在加工过程中的移动速度。通过调整F代码的数值,可以控制机床的进给速度,从而实现不同的加工效果。

5. S代码

S代码用于设置主轴转速,它决定了机床在加工过程中的主轴转速。通过调整S代码的数值,可以控制机床的主轴转速,从而实现不同的加工要求。

6. X、Y、Z代码

X、Y、Z代码用于设置机床在加工过程中的坐标位置。通过编写X、Y、Z代码,可以控制机床在不同的坐标轴上进行移动,实现精确的加工操作。

7. D代码

D代码用于设置刀具的补偿值,它可以根据实际情况对刀具进行微调。通过编写D代码,可以实现刀具的补偿功能,提高加工的精度和质量。

8. I、J、K代码

I、J、K代码用于定义圆弧的半径和圆心位置。通过编写I、J、K代码,可以实现机床在加工过程中的圆弧插补,从而完成复杂形状的加工需求。

9. R代码

R代码用于定义圆弧的半径,它可以用于控制圆弧的大小。通过编写R代码,可以实现不同半径的圆弧加工,满足不同加工要求。

10. N代码

N代码用于给程序中的每个指令进行编号,它可以用于标记程序的执行顺序。通过编写N代码,可以实现程序的跳转和循环执行,提高编程的灵活性和效率。

11. L代码

L代码用于定义子程序的起始位置和结束位置,它可以用于实现程序的模块化编程。通过编写L代码,可以将复杂的加工过程分解成多个子程序,提高编程的可读性和维护性。

九游会J9

12. C代码

C代码用于定义循环的次数,它可以用于实现程序的重复执行。通过编写C代码,可以实现相同加工过程的重复执行,提高编程的效率。

cnc车床代码有哪些

以上是CNC车床代码中的一些常见指令和功能,通过灵活运用这些代码,可以实现各种复杂的加工操作。掌握CNC车床代码的基本知识,对于提高加工效率和质量具有重要意义。希望本文的介绍能够引起读者对CNC车床代码的兴趣,并为读者提供了一定的背景信息。